Using a printable monthly budget template is easy. Simply download the template, print it out, and fill in your income and expenses for the month. Be sure to include all of your income sources, as well as all of your expenses, including rent, utilities, groceries, and entertainment. Once you have a clear picture of your financial situation, you can start making adjustments to achieve your financial goals. Remember to review and update your budget regularly to ensure you're on track to meet your financial objectives.
